Output 44a86177e293ae1126ef4f4902c6f260427a4c7e6173ed33fdb2c4a9127ba84b:4

value
43755407
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4392ba59972acf581a8416eb0e375961bf8ff1453ee25896c9a94dc49441c183
address
tb1pgwft5kvh9t84sx5yzm4sud6evxlclu298m3939kf49xuf9zpcxpsdl9wep
transaction
44a86177e293ae1126ef4f4902c6f260427a4c7e6173ed33fdb2c4a9127ba84b
confirmations
63539
spent
true